Descrizione:The following article presents a critique of the Costa Rican psychiatric reform, to the extent that it creates a critical discursive universe of psychiatric institutions, but that in its praxis strengthens the model of hegemony of psychiatry in mental health care. This through psychopolitical strategies that are manifested through public policy and deny the critical participation of users, ex-users and mental health activists, who propose decentralized, autonomous and humanist strategies for mental health care.
